Here are some fresh and fun ideas for your next spring mani that stray far from the usual suspects.


1. Botanical Bliss

Why settle for plain colors when nature is your inspiration? Spring is the time to embrace delicate botanical accents. Think thin, hand-painted vines or leaf motifs on neutral tones. A soft blush pink base with a delicate eucalyptus leaf design can evoke the feeling of a serene walk through a garden.




2. Soft Pastel Ombre

While pastel nails are a classic for spring, the ombre twist makes them feel fresh and modern. Gradually transitioning from one color to another (like soft lavender fading into a creamy peach) offers a dreamy, ethereal look. For an extra touch, you can add a shimmer effect to the tips or a subtle glitter gradient to catch the light.




3. Unexpected Textures

Textures are becoming more popular in nail design, and spring is the perfect time to experiment. Imagine pairing pastel colors with a matte finish on one hand and a glossy top coat on the other. Or, opt for a "soft-touch" finish in colors like mint green or pale lavender. Adding texture to your nails can make even the simplest designs feel elevated.







4. Minimalist Metallic Dots

If you love minimalist designs but still want to add a hint of sparkle, try tiny metallic dots placed strategically along the nail. Think gold or silver for a classy, understated touch of elegance. A nude base with scattered metallic dots gives off a sophisticated yet playful vibe.




5. Translucent Nails

A growing trend for 2025, translucent nails are a fresh take on the classic "barely-there" look. They offer a clean and polished appearance with a hint of color, giving your nails a luminous glow. This trend works beautifully with sheer peach or soft lilac shades that give the illusion of a second skin.







6. Sculptural Nails

For the bold souls, sculptural nails are the new frontier. Think of 3D nail art—subtle, of course! A pop of color with geometric shapes or a single sculpted element like a raised pearl on a matte black base gives your nails the perfect blend of art and elegance. It's simple but definitely makes a statement.

7. Color-Blocked Tips

Ditch the classic French mani and try a color-blocked twist. Instead of the traditional white tip, mix things up with pastel blue, coral, or soft yellow tips on a nude or clear base. The geometric feel gives your nails a modern, refreshing look without being too over-the-top.





8. Cloudy Skies

Take inspiration from the fluffy clouds of spring by creating soft, cloud-like designs on your nails. Whether you’re using a white base with little swirls of pastel blue or purple to mimic the sky, this design feels breezy, calming, and perfect for a spring mood. Add tiny sparkles here and there to capture the essence of a spring afternoon.

9. Vintage Floral Accents

Floral patterns are a timeless spring trend, but this season we’re leaning into vintage florals. Think of muted colors like dusty rose or soft lavender paired with retro-inspired daisies or wildflower patterns. These designs give a subtle nod to the '70s and offer a refreshing, nostalgic vibe without being too bold.




10. Neon Pastels

If you want to mix a little edge with your classic spring nails, neon pastels might just be your go-to. These colors feel like a soft pastel on the surface but pack a punch when the light hits them. A soft neon peach or mint green base with a single nail in a contrasting color can bring an unexpected pop to your look.
